Web14 aug. 2024 · In February 1947, the British government announced that India would be granted independence by June 1948. Viceroy for India Louis Mountbatten (1900–1979) pleaded with the Hindu and Muslim leaders to agree to form a united country, but they could not. Only Gandhi supported Mountbatten's position. Web1 mrt. 2024 · Indian Independence Act of 1947. On 20th February 1947, British Prime Minister Clement Atlee declared that British Rule in India will come to end by 30 June 1948. On 3 June 1947, Lord Mountbatten put a Partition plan known as Mountbatten Plan. Mountbatten’s plan was accepted by Congress and the Muslim league.

Web14 aug. 2024 · The league was located in various parts of Southeast Asia. Indian Independence Act of 1947: The Indian Independence Act was an act of the Parliament of the United Kingdom. The act partitioned British India into two new independent dominions of India and Pakistan. It received the assent of the royal family on 18th July 1947.
